I remember reading a posting from Danny (digitex) when I had completed treatment and was spiraling into a horrible depression. Danny talked about how all he wanted to do was sit at home on rather then do anything. That was how I felt for awhile. Danny also posted how he began to take a walk every single day and how it helped. I started doing the same thing, and it did more for me then any medicine did. A good start for Stephen, I think, is to at the very least get out of the bed. Take a daily shower at a minimum, if possible, get out of the house once a day.
